Practical Publisher Notes Before You Deploy

Before dropping Bugaboo into your next digital download or affiliate marketing graphic, run these checks:

  1. Preview it on both desktop and mobile—especially inside your actual blog layout, not just in design software.
  2. Test how it renders as a 150×150px thumbnail on Pinterest or in email clients.
  3. Try it with real headline copy—not just “Hello”—to gauge rhythm and spacing.
  4. Check contrast against your background using browser dev tools or a free contrast checker.
  5. Convert to black-and-white: does the shape still read clearly? (Important for accessibility and printables.)
  6. Place it beside common pairing fonts: a serif (like Merriweather), a sans-serif (Inter or Lato), a script (Dancing Script), and a display font (Montserrat Black). Does it complement—or compete?
  7. Confirm file size: color fonts can be larger; compress accompanying PNG/SVG exports without sacrificing crispness.
  8. Verify commercial license terms—especially if you’re embedding it in paid digital products, affiliate content visuals, or client-facing Canva templates.
